Chariots of Fire is a musical adaptation of the 1981 film. It tells the true story of two British athletes who overcame huge odds and prejudices by competing in the 1924 Olympics.

Beautiful Beatrice-Joanna is in love - so she hires the repellent De Flores to kill the man her father wants her to marry. But once the deed's done Beatrice discovers it's not money or jewels that De Flores claims as his reward, but something far more precious.
